2866 Plays
2581 Plays
2615 Plays
2436 Plays
2586 Plays
2701 Plays
DESCRIPTION: Happy farm is a very fun game where you need to feed the animals on the farm with their respective food. Feed as often as you can and compete with your friends.
Comments